The downfall of a dictator’s spy chief

About this episode
"His Excellency doesn't allow his second-in-command to live."In the 2020 movie "The Man Standing Next," the character Park Yong-gak, based on former Korean Central Intelligence Agency chief Kim Hyung-wook, utters the ominous line about then-President Park Chung-hee.Kim, once at the pinnacle of power, went missing after last being seen at a hotel casino in Paris on Oct. 7, 1979.This episode delves into conspiracy theories surrounding the mysterious death of Kim Hyung-wook, an intelligence chief-turned-whistleblower under the Park Chung-hee dictatorship.
